The Atmospheric Correction Intercomparison eXercise (ACIX) is a collaborative initiative under the Committee on Earth Observation Satellites Working Group on Calibration & Validation (CEOS WGCV), jointly coordinated by ESA and NASA. ACIX‑IV Land represents the next phase of this activity, continuing to engage the community of atmospheric correction (AC) processor developers in a structured intercomparison framework.

The exercise will start in the occasion of the 1st ACIX‑IV workshop, to be held at ESRIN on 30 November – 1 December, which will bring together coordinators and participants to jointly define the protocol, datasets, and implementation approach. As in previous editions, this collaborative setup will ensure consistency and transparency throughout the exercise.

ACIX‑IV Land will rely on a combination of simulated, realistic scenes and real satellite observations. Activities will include the processing and analysis of simulated Sentinel‑2 and CHIME Top‑Of‑Atmosphere data observations produced by the DTE-S2GOS scene generator across a wide range of land cover types, seasonal conditions, and atmospheric scenarios. These will be complemented by the exploitation of Sentinel‑2 and Landsat‑8/9 observations acquired over well‑characterised reference sites.

Through the intercomparison of results produced by different processors, the exercise aims to evaluate performance across diverse conditions, identify strengths and limitations of current approaches, and highlight similarities and differences in algorithm behaviour. The outcomes are expected to support ongoing improvements in atmospheric correction methods and contribute to the development of increasingly robust, consistent, and harmonised land EO products.
